MSP430V325IRHAR Description

The Texas Instruments MSP430V325IRHAR is a low-power, 16-bit microcontroller (MCU) that belongs to the MSP430 Value Line series. It is designed for a wide range of applications, including industrial, consumer, and automotive markets. Here's a brief description, features, and applications of the MSP430V325IRHAR:

Description:

The MSP430V325IRHAR is a highly integrated, mixed-signal MCU that combines the performance of a 16-bit CPU with the low-power consumption and integrated peripherals required for various applications. It is based on the RISC architecture, which allows for efficient code execution and reduced power consumption.

Features:

  1. CPU: 16-bit RISC CPU with a clock speed of up to 8MHz.
  2. Memory: 8KB of on-chip flash memory for program storage and 256B of RAM for data storage.
  3. Power Management: Ultra-low-power consumption with multiple low-power modes, including standby and sleep modes.
  4. Integrated Peripherals: On-chip peripherals include a 10-bit ADC, 2x 8-bit timers, a watchdog timer, and a UART for communication.
  5. Connectivity: The device features a UART for serial communication, which can be used for interfacing with other devices or microcontrollers.
  6. Security: The MSP430V325IRHAR includes a built-in security module that provides protection against unauthorized access and tampering.
  7. Package: The MCU is available in a 20-pin QFN (Quad Flat No-Leads) package, which is suitable for space-constrained applications.
